The Fact About Sugar and Cavities



You ought to know that sugar consumption is a major factor to tooth decay.

When you eat sweet foods and beverages, the germs in your mouth feed on the sugars and produce acids. These acids assault the enamel, the safety external layer of your teeth, triggering it to damage and break down over time.

Unmasking the Misconception of Brushing Harder for Cleaner Pearly Whites



Don't think the misconception that cleaning harder will certainly result in cleaner teeth. Many individuals think that using more stress while cleaning will certainly remove extra plaque and germs from their teeth. Nevertheless, this isn't real, and in fact, it can be hazardous to your oral health.

Cleaning as well hard can damage your tooth enamel and irritate your periodontals, bring about level of sensitivity and periodontal recession. The key to effective brushing isn't compel, yet strategy and uniformity.

It's recommended to make use of a soft-bristled toothbrush and gentle, circular movements to clean up all surface areas of your teeth. In addition, brushing for a minimum of two mins twice a day, along with routine flossing and oral examinations, is crucial for preserving a healthy smile.

Common Dental Myths: What You Required to Know



Don't be deceived by the myth that sugar is the main culprit behind dental caries and cavities.

While it holds true that sugar can contribute to dental troubles, it isn't the single reason.



Tooth decay takes place when hazardous microorganisms in your mouth prey on the sugars and starches from the foods you consume.

These germs create acids that deteriorate the enamel, causing cavities.

Nevertheless, inadequate dental hygiene, such as poor brushing and flossing, plays a substantial role in the development of dental cavity as well.

In addition, certain elements like genes, completely dry mouth, and acidic foods can also contribute to dental problems.
